The blackrock hut (shelter) is located in the southern district of shenandoah national park and is an example of the hut style of shelter, built from stone and logs
Blackrock hut is a shelter in albemarle, virginia Blackrock hut is situated nearby to blackrock springs, as well as near the peak pinestand mountain
